Note: Often, the weight might be indicated by a number. The number decreases as the canvas thickness boosts. # 12 translates to 11.5 oz, # 10 to 15 oz and # 8 to 18 oz (around). The phoned number weight is not uniform from firm to business. An Epson Ink Jet printer. A newly printed, Gicle canvas.Canvas printing for aqueous ink printers generally have a much more restricted canvas width. Canvas rolls are an optimum of 64" (5 feet) broad. This suggests a rolled canvas print can not be even more than 64" broad, and if the canvas will certainly be extended, the picture can not exceed 60" in size, to permit the excess called for to cover around the cot bar frame.

(https://form.typeform.com/to/gVxFcutl): Gloss finishes are most usual for canvases made use of in solvent printers, instead than Ink Jet. When a glossy print is extended (as lots of published on Ink Jet printers are), it risks of fracturing when the fibers broaden. This can be stopped by adding a finish, yet there are particular canvas suppliers who sell gloss canvas assured not to break also when incomplete.
These can include OBAs (optical lightening up agents), that make the canvas a brighter white, decreasing the all-natural cream or beige of the fabric. Other ingredients might improve shade top quality, improve the security for an archival-grade rating, make the canvas a lot more responsive to the ink. This enhancement of the photo is developed by increasing the density of the shades, making blacks blacker and blues brighter. The varnish secures the canvas by providing additional UV defense (the inks themselves will certainly currently have some), water-proofing the surface, and inhibiting scratches, fractures, and chips. Post-printing coatings might be applied either by spraying or repainting the material onto the canvas, though there are devices that do it immediately, also.

There can not be any dust bits floating about, and the location must be aerated. It is necessary to ensure the ink is completely dry before the finish is applied, which the coating has actually entirely dried out before the canvas is stretched. If the ink, canvas and coverings on a Gicle canvas print are all acid free, the print is most likely to be of historical top quality.
This obviously assumes that the canvas is properly presented in an area without direct light or extreme humidity changes The finish will protect the canvas from light and acid damages (canvas print artwork). The very first acrylic paints were marketed to the public in the 1950s, which provides a much shorter background than oil paints. Polymers are water-based and are consequently a lot easier to clean up
Polymers are quite flexible, and this elasticity permits them to stand up more than time, without breaking on the canvas surface. Specific Click This Link acrylic paints can be related to a variety of substratums, including canvas, wood, paper, even fabric, and work for multimedias; they can be incorporated with sand or rice, to produce a structure.
